International Tax Institute (IIFS)

The International Tax Institute (IIFS) offers a comprehensive Master's program in international taxation.


M.I.Tax Program

The M.I.Tax program guarantees participants comprehensive training in the various fields of international taxation, covering areas such as Business Administration, Tax Planning, Taxation Law, and Finance in an integrated manner.


  • Duration: 1 year (October - September), Master's dissertation
  • Lecture days: Fridays and Saturdays, 9 am - 5 pm, around 33 weekends
  • Holiday: Christmas, March, Easter, and Whitsun
  • Languages of instruction: German and English; fluent knowledge of the German language is absolutely essential
  • Academic requirements: Applicants must be university or polytechnic graduates in Economics, Law, or similar subject
  • Degree awarded: Master of International Taxation
  • Tuition fee: 12,500 Euro (at the time of publication)
  • Application deadline: 15th of July

Program Details

The program covers basic principles such as taxation of residents and non-residents, methods of avoiding double taxation, and the specific principles of the taxation of international activities. Emphasis is also put upon the analysis of tax systems in selected countries, including Western European countries, the USA, and reformed countries recently accepted as EU members.


Research Areas

The program explores various research areas, including international taxation, tax planning, and finance. Participants attend the annual Hamburg International Tax Conference, which provides a platform for discussion and networking.


Accreditation

The MITax program is officially accredited by AQAS ("Agency for Quality Assurance through Accreditation of Study Programs").
